Ghazala Bukhari is an Islamabad-based fashion designer and the founder and creative director of the Ghazala Bukhari fashion house. Her work brings together textile artistry, traditional Pakistani craftsmanship, contemporary silhouettes and a deeply personal approach to luxury fashion.
Formally launched in 2017, the label has presented internationally through Pakistan Fashion Week London, APPNA in the United States and Boulevard One in Dubai, while continuing to develop its creative identity from its atelier in Bani Gala, Islamabad.

Ghazala Bukhari's relationship with design began long before the formal creation of her label. Art, nature, colour and textiles shaped her creative vocabulary and eventually led to advanced study in Fine Arts with a major focus on Textile Design at Fatima Jinnah Women University.
Her academic and artistic foundation informs the way she approaches fashion today. Rather than treating embroidery or surface decoration as an afterthought, she develops garments through an understanding of textile, colour composition, print, embellishment, proportion and movement.
Her work has become particularly associated with designer shawls, heritage-inspired handwork, formal occasion wear and bridal pieces that balance Pakistani tradition with a contemporary point of view.
From the Islamabad atelier, Ghazala continues to develop the house as a distinctive Pakistani fashion identity: personal in its approach, rooted in craft and increasingly connected to a national and international clientele.

International exposure formed part of the Ghazala Bukhari story from the early years of the label.
The Ghazala Bukhari Label
Ghazala Bukhari formally launched her designer label in 2017, developing a fashion identity informed by textile design, Pakistani craftsmanship and wearable art.
Pakistan Fashion Week London
The designer's first international exhibition took place at Pakistan Fashion Week London, introducing the Ghazala Bukhari aesthetic to an overseas fashion audience.
APPNA
Ghazala Bukhari later showcased her work at APPNA in the United States, extending the label's relationship with the Pakistani diaspora and international clients.
Boulevard One
The label also presented at Boulevard One in Dubai, adding another international chapter to the Ghazala Bukhari journey.

Who is Ghazala Bukhari?
Ghazala Bukhari is a Pakistani fashion designer, textile artist and founder and creative director of the Ghazala Bukhari fashion house in Islamabad. Her work combines Pakistani heritage craftsmanship, textile design, signature shawls, bridal couture, luxury prêt and occasion wear.
When was the Ghazala Bukhari label launched?
The Ghazala Bukhari label was formally launched in 2017. In December of the same year, Ghazala presented at Pakistan Fashion Week London.
Where has Ghazala Bukhari showcased internationally?
Ghazala Bukhari has showcased her work at Pakistan Fashion Week London, at APPNA in the United States and at Boulevard One in Dubai, in addition to exhibitions and fashion activity in Pakistan.
What is Ghazala Bukhari known for?
The fashion house is particularly associated with signature designer shawls, textile artistry, traditional handwork, bridal and occasion wear, luxury prêt and designs that reinterpret Pakistani cultural references through a contemporary fashion language.
